Posted: Mon Sep 09, 2013 4:44 pm
by hks_kansei
Pretty much.
People buying standard parts tend to also be looking for a bargain.



Personally I think the business would probably need to offer services as well, it's hard to survive as a parts retailer for only one model.
Look at Mania and Plus,they both sell parts, but I imagine the majority of their income is from performing services for people rather than retail.



The big issue is that I doubt the MX5 Centre name has that much goodwill left. It was pretty much abandoned when James moved, which didnt do any favours for the name in the relatively small Aussie MX5 circle (and the even smaller Melbourne one)
